Hello Bruce, OK, I got it working. I moved just the 2 2.1.12 jar files -- jaxb-api.jar & jaxb-impl.jar, directly to my /opt/isv/activemq/fuse-mb/lib

I tried the 2.1.12, and then even tried the > 2.2. > > > > I downloaded from https://jaxb.dev.java.net/ and installed into the > following directories > > $ pwd > > /opt/isv/activemq/fuse-mb/lib > > $ ls > > camel-jetty-2.2.0-fuse-01-00.jar > geronimo-jta_1.0.1B_spec-1.0.1.jar > > activation-1.1.jar camel-jms-2.2.0-fuse-01-00.jar > jaxb-ri-20090708 > > activemq-camel-5.3.1-fuse-00-00.jar camel-juel-2.2.0-fuse-01-00.jar > jaxb-ri-20091104 > > activemq-console-5.3.1-fuse-00-00.jar camel-spring-2.2.0-fuse-01-00.jar > juel-2.1.2.jar > > activemq-core-5.3.1-fuse-00-00.jar commons-logging-1.1.jar > kahadb-5.3.1-fuse-00-00.jar > > activemq-jaas-5.3.1-fuse-00-00.jar commons-management-1.0.jar > optional > > activemq-protobuf-1.0.0.0-fuse.jar geronimo-el_1.0_spec-1.0.1.jar > stax-1.2.0.jar > > activemq-web-5.3.1-fuse-00-00.jar > geronimo-j2ee-management_1.0_spec-1.0.jar stax-api-1.0.1.jar > > camel-core-2.2.0-fuse-01-00.jar geronimo-jms_1.1_spec-1.1.1.jar > web > > > > $ cd jaxb-ri-20090708 > > > > $ ls > > bin docs lib License.txt samples ThirdPartyLicenseReadme.txt > > > > $ cd lib > > $ ls > > activation.jar jaxb1-impl-src.zip jaxb-api.jar jaxb-impl.jar > jaxb-xjc.jar jsr173_1.0_api.jar > > jaxb1-impl.jar jaxb-api-doc.zip jaxb-api-src.zip jaxb-impl.src.zip > jaxb-xjc.src.zip Based on what I see above, you just downloaded the entire JAXB distribution and unzipped the archive in the ActiveMQ lib directory. You need to place the jaxb-api jar and the jaxb-impl jar in the ActiveMQ lib directory, not the JAXB distribution directory. Furthermore, you need to make sure that you are using the appropriate JAXB jar versions for the version of Camel that you are using. What version of Camel are you using?
